Recently, a video showing a student feeding a corndog to his differently-abled friend at a school canteen went viral on social media.

Screenshot 2 1

 

In the video, it showed a male student sitting at the school canteen with a group of friends, including a boy who didn’t have any hands.

As his friend was unable to feed himself, the male student took it upon himself to hold out the corndog for his differently-abled friend to eat without any problems.

Screenshot 3 1

 

The differently-abled boy seemed to be delighted as he was able to enjoy his meal with the rest of his friends.

It is unclear where this act of kindness occurred, however, some netizens claimed that it happened at a school in Thailand.

 

Heartwarming friendship

The video has since gone viral on Twitter where netizens praised the actions of the student who had no qualms about ensuring that his differently-abled friend gets to eat as well.
